一、区域定价管理的核心需求
1. 地理差异化定价
- 不同区域(如城市、行政区、商圈)的消费水平、物流成本、竞争环境不同,需针对性定价。
- 示例:一线城市生鲜价格可能高于三四线城市,或同一城市内不同区域因配送距离差异调整价格。
2. 动态调整能力
- 根据实时供需(如突发天气导致蔬菜短缺)、竞争对手价格、促销活动等动态调整价格。
- 示例:节假日前夕上调热门商品价格,或凌晨时段对易损耗商品降价促销。
3. 合规性与公平性
- 避免价格歧视风险,需符合《反垄断法》《价格法》等法规,确保定价逻辑透明可解释。
- 示例:通过算法模型自动生成价格,避免人为干预导致的法律风险。
二、技术实现方案
1. 数据层设计
- 区域数据建模
- 建立区域维度表(如行政区划、配送网格、商圈ID),关联商品价格规则。
- 使用地理围栏技术(Geo-fencing)划分区域,支持多级嵌套(如省→市→区→配送站)。
- 价格规则引擎
- 规则配置化:支持通过后台界面设置区域、商品、时间、价格类型(原价/促销价)等条件。
- 规则优先级:定义规则冲突时的执行顺序(如“区域A的促销价”优先于“全局默认价”)。
- 实时数据采集
- 集成外部数据源:天气API、竞品价格监控、物流成本计算模型。
- 内部数据:用户行为(如区域购买力)、库存水位、历史销售数据。
2. 算法层设计
- 定价策略算法
- 成本加成模型:基础价 = 采购成本 + 物流成本 + 区域加成系数。
- 供需平衡模型:根据区域库存周转率动态调整价格(如高周转商品降价)。
- 竞品对标模型:监控竞品价格,自动触发调价(如竞品降价5%时跟进)。
- 机器学习优化
- 训练价格弹性模型:分析历史数据,预测不同区域的价格敏感度。
- 强化学习应用:通过A/B测试优化定价策略,最大化区域利润或GMV。
3. 系统架构
- 微服务架构
- 独立定价服务:接收区域、商品、时间等参数,返回计算后的价格。
- 与订单、库存、支付系统解耦,避免单点故障。
- 缓存与CDN
- 区域价格数据缓存至Redis,减少数据库查询压力。
- 通过CDN加速价格接口响应,确保用户端快速展示。
- 监控与告警
- 实时监控价格计算耗时、规则命中率、异常调价事件。
- 设置阈值告警(如某区域价格突增50%),防止系统错误。
三、业务场景示例
1. 节假日保供定价
- 春节前,系统自动识别“北上广深”等高消费区域,对礼盒类商品上浮10%,同时对基础民生商品(如大米、鸡蛋)保持原价。
2. 极端天气应对
- 暴雨预警触发物流成本加成,受影响区域生鲜价格动态上调8%,并推送用户解释性文案(如“因恶劣天气,配送成本增加”)。
3. 新区域开拓
- 在三四线城市试点“低价引流”策略,对部分标品设置低于一线城市的价格,快速获取市场份额。
四、挑战与解决方案
1. 数据准确性
- 挑战:区域边界模糊(如郊区与城区交界处)。
- 方案:结合用户收货地址的GPS坐标与行政区划数据,实现精准区域匹配。
2. 规则冲突
- 挑战:多规则叠加(如“区域A促销”+“会员折扣”+“满减活动”)。
- 方案:定义规则执行顺序(如促销价优先于会员折扣),或通过组合规则引擎统一计算。
3. 用户体验
- 挑战:用户发现相邻区域价格差异可能引发不满。
- 方案:在价格展示页增加区域说明(如“当前价格为XX区专属价”),或提供跨区域比价功能。
五、合规与风控
1. 审计日志
- 记录所有价格调整操作,包括触发条件、调整幅度、操作人。
2. 熔断机制
- 当价格波动超过阈值(如单日涨幅超20%)时,自动暂停调价并人工复核。
3. 用户告知
- 在价格变动前通过App推送、短信等方式通知用户,避免信息不对称。
六、未来优化方向
1. LBS动态定价
- 结合用户实时位置(如靠近竞品门店时)触发临时调价。
2. 个性化定价
- 根据用户历史购买行为、价格敏感度,对同一区域用户展示差异化价格(需严格合规)。
3. 区块链存证
- 将定价规则与调整记录上链,确保不可篡改,提升透明度。
通过区域定价管理,美团买菜可实现“千区千价”的精细化运营,在保障用户体验的同时,最大化平台收益。技术实现需兼顾灵活性(支持快速规则调整)与稳定性(避免价格计算错误),业务层面需平衡商业利益与社会责任。